EventsLocationsUnited KingdomFood & DrinkPedal & Pour
Doe and Fawn Coffee Roasters
Unit 3, The Grainstores, MK17 8AP, Milton Keynes, England, United Kingdom
View Map
Doe and Fawn Coffee Roasters
Unit 3, The Grainstores, MK17 8AP, Milton Keynes, England, United Kingdom